Josiah Seth Stafford 1808–1862 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 12 May 1808

Birth Location: Beaufort County, South Carolina, United States of America

Death Date: 6 May 1862

Death Location: Houston, Harris County, Texas, United States of America

Father: Leroy Stafford

Mother: Rachel Audebert

Spouse(s): Jeannetta Stafford

Children(s): William Stafford

The story of Josiah Seth Stafford began in 1808 in Beaufort County, South Carolina, United States of America. Josiah Seth Stafford married Jeannetta Stafford, and had children including William Maynord Manor Stafford. Josiah Seth Stafford passed away in 1862 in Houston, Harris County, Texas, United States of America.
